Description
'There have been several books about the lost boys of Sudan for adults, teens, and even for
elementary-school readers. But [this] spare, immediate account, based on a true story, adds a
stirring contemporary dimension. . . . Young readers will be stunned by the triumphant climax.'Â
—Booklist, starred review'[This] spare, hard-hitting novel delivers a memorable portrait of two
children in Sudan. . . . Tragic and harrowing.'— Publishers Weekly, starred review 'Two
narratives intersect in a quiet conclusion that is filled with hope.'—School Library Journal,Â
starred review'This powerful dual narrative packs suspense and introspection into Park's
characteristic spare description; while there are lots of details offered to the reader, they come not
in long, prosaic lines but in simple, detached observations. Both Salva's and Nya's stories are told
with brutal, simple honesty, and they deliver remarkable perspective on the Sudanese conflict. The
novel's brevity and factual basis makes the reality of life in Sudan very accessible, and readers will
find both the story and the style extremely moving.'—The Bulletin 'Park simply yet convincingly
depicts the chaos of war and an unforgiving landscape. . . . A heartfelt account.'—Kirkus
Reviews 'Brilliant. . . . A touching narrative about strife and survival on a scale most American
readers will never see.'— Book Page'Riveting.'—The Horn Book'[A] fast, page-turning read. . .
. A great book for high school students and an important novel for young adults who enjoy learning
